What role does the New Jersey State Police Private Detective Unit play in the SORA process?

The New Jersey State Police Private Detective Unit is a pivotal entity in the SORA process as it is responsible for issuing the SORA license. This license is essential for security officers who wish to legally operate within the state of New Jersey, confirming that the individual has completed the necessary requirements, including training and background checks.

By issuing the SORA license, the Private Detective Unit helps ensure that only qualified individuals are permitted to work in security positions, thus maintaining a level of professionalism and safety within the industry. This function underscores the unit's vital role in monitoring and regulating security personnel to protect the interests of both business and public safety.

While other responsibilities, such as conducting background checks and overseeing fingerprinting processes, are also critical components of the registration process, the specific task of issuing the license is central to the enforcement of SORA regulations and the compliance of security officers with state laws.
